GCF of 16 and 24

Find the Greatest Common Factor (GCF) of 16 and 24 with a complete step-by-step solution. The GCF is the largest number that divides both numbers without leaving a remainder.

Answer: GCF(16, 24) = 8
Step-by-Step Solution
Step 1 Find the Factors of 16

To find the GCF of 16 and 24, we first need to find all factors of each number.

The factors of 16 are numbers that divide 16 evenly:


1 × 16 = 16, 2 × 8 = 16, 4 × 4 = 16

Factors of 16: 1, 2, 4, 8, 16

Step 2 Find the Factors of 24

Now we find all factors of 24:


1 × 24 = 24, 2 × 12 = 24, 3 × 8 = 24, 4 × 6 = 24

Factors of 24: 1, 2, 3, 4, 6, 8, 12, 24

Step 3 Find the Common Factors

The common factors are numbers that appear in both lists:


Factors of 16: 1, 2, 4, 8, 16

Factors of 24: 1, 2, 3, 4, 6, 8, 12, 24


Common factors: 1, 2, 4, 8


The Greatest Common Factor is the largest of these: 8

Step 4 Prime Factorization Method

We can also find the GCF using prime factorization:


16 = 2^4
24 = 2^3 × 3

Take the common prime factors with the lowest powers:

GCF = 2 × 2 × 2 = 8
Step 5 Euclidean Algorithm

The Euclidean algorithm is a fast way to find the GCF using repeated division:


24 = 1 × 16 + 8
16 = 2 × 8 + 0

When the remainder is 0, the GCF is the last divisor: 8

Step 6 Final Answer

GCF(16, 24) = 8
